Position Title:

SAP Client Executive – Supply Chain Management (South/East Region)

Position Summary: We are seeking an experienced SAP Supply Chain Management (SCM) Sales Executive with a strong background in supply chain planning solutions, including IBP and PP/DS, to drive the adoption of SAP’s advanced supply chain solutions across the South and East regions. The ideal candidate will have deep expertise in supply chain planning and optimization, helping organizations modernize and digitize their planning capabilities across demand planning, supply planning, and production planning. 

Key Responsibilities:

  • Sales Performance: Achieve and consistently exceed sales targets within the South & East regions by driving demand for SAP’s supply chain solutions. Manage end-to-end sales cycles from lead qualification to closing.
  • Client Engagement: Build and maintain strong relationships with C-level executives, advising on how SAP’s solutions can enhance their supply chain operations and support broader business transformation.
  • Sales Strategy: Work closely with pre-sales and demo teams to craft tailored value propositions that address customer pain points and align with their business goals.
  • Solution Selling: Position SAP’s solutions alongside Argano capabilities as the key enabler of supply chain optimization, focusing on areas such as logistics, procurement, manufacturing, and supply chain planning.
  • Market Leadership: Stay current on trends and best practices in supply chain management, bringing relevant insights into client discussions to position SAP as an industry leader.
  • Willingness and ability to travel to client sites as needed to support sales engagements and relationship development.

Must-Have Criteria:

  • Experience:
    • 4–6 years of field sales experience with a focus on B2B enterprise software and/or professional services, ideally within the supply chain technology ecosystem.
    • A history of consistently overachieving sales targets, evidenced by percent-to-goal performance, club awards, or leaderboard rankings.
    • Expertise in managing complex sales cycles, from qualification through to closing, and a demonstrated ability to close large, strategic deals.
    • Experience engaging and influencing C-level and senior supply chain leaders to drive transformation initiatives and secure high-value business outcomes.
    • At least 2 years of enterprise software sales experience, preferably within the SAP ecosystem, a technology vendor, consulting firm, or value-added reseller.
    • Experience selling or supporting supply chain planning solutions (e.g., SAP IBP, PP/DS, or related planning platforms) is strongly preferred.
    • Familiarity with the South and East enterprise client landscape is a strong plus.
  • Sales Acumen:
    • Ability to sell business value rather than simply product features, with a focus on how SAP solutions drive supply chain transformation.
    • Comfort working alongside pre-sales teams to create compelling value propositions and guide sales discussions.
    • Proven ability to guide discovery sessions, navigate executive-level priorities, and align SAP’s offerings to client business needs.
  • Supply Chain Knowledge:
    • Deep understanding of key supply chain concepts, including supply chain planning, logistics, procurement, manufacturing, and distribution.
    • Prior experience selling or working with solutions designed to optimize or digitize supply chain operations.

What you need to know about the San Francisco Tech Scene

San Francisco and the surrounding Bay Area attracts more startup funding than any other region in the world. Home to Stanford University and UC Berkeley, leading VC firms and several of the world’s most valuable companies, the Bay Area is the place to go for anyone looking to make it big in the tech industry. That said, San Francisco has a lot to offer beyond technology thanks to a thriving art and music scene, excellent food and a short drive to several of the country’s most beautiful recreational areas.

Key Facts About San Francisco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 365,500; 13.9%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Google, Apple, Salesforce, Meta
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, fintech, consumer technology, software
  • Funding Landscape: $50.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Sequoia Capital, Andreessen Horowitz, Bessemer Venture Partners, Greylock Partners, Khosla Ventures, Kleiner Perkins
  • Research Centers and Universities: Stanford University; University of California, Berkeley; University of San Francisco; Santa Clara University; Ames Research Center; Center for AI Safety; California Institute for Regenerative Medicine
